BK64 WHE is a 2014 Citroen C1 in Grey with a 998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.9%.

Across all 2014 Citroen C1 models, the average MOT pass rate is 83.0% with a typical mileage of 38,297 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Citroen C1 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 31,976 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BK64 WHE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Citroen C1 typ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 12 years old, this Citroen C1 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
